June Galyon Partain, 86, passed away November 5, 2021. Mrs. Partain was born at home in Erie, Tennessee on June 18, 1935 to William Frank and Nora Mae Galyon. She was the youngest of 7 children: brothers, Garland, Clarence, Hershel, Marvin; sisters, Audrey and Maxine. She graduated from Midway High School in 1953 and from Tennessee Tech in 1957. June taught elementary school one year at her childhood school. After she married Lee Partain from Athens, TN, they moved to Atlanta, Georgia where Lee accepted a job with the FDIC. In 1960, Cobb County became home when Lee began his 35 year career in banking. During her life, she was an active and supportive wife, mother, and grandmother. PTA, Cub Scouts, Band Booster, Room Mom, and Sunday School teacher were a few jobs she participated in as a "homemaker." She enjoyed flowers, sewing, baking, traveling, and her grandson! She was a longtime member of Glen Forest Baptist Church and Lost Mountain Baptist Church. Currently, her sister Maxine Elkins, lives in Loudon, TN and her daughter, Nerissa (Nissa) DeLisle and her husband, Robert, and grandson, Chris, live in Powder Springs, GA; her son, Scott and his wife, Tracy live in Rydal, GA.
